000003310 520__ $$2eng$$aFor a complete description of two-phase flow a basic information about liquid phase formation is needed. The information is fulfilled in terms of nucleation rate and its dependency on quantities characteristic for gas-phase flow. One of devices used for measuring of nucleation rate in multi-component systems of vapors and gases is a shock tube. Unique modification of this device designed for measuring in chemically aggressive mixtures has been developed recently in the Laboratory of Phase Transition Kinetics in Institute of Thermomechanics, Academy of Sciences of The Czech Republic. The aim of the paper is to give a basic overview of the method for measurement of the nucleation rate. Special attention is paid to the design of each part of the laboratory setup.
